Agstack
Agstack is an open-source digital infrastructure project under the Linux Foundation that focuses on building composable data, software, and standards for agriculture and food systems.
- Open-source agricultural data and software infrastructure for interoperability and reuse
- Reference architectures and common frameworks for digital agriculture solutions (data platforms)
- Domain-specific data models, ontologies, and standards for farm and food system data (data management)
- Community-driven governance, working groups, and code repositories for agritech stakeholders
- Integration patterns for geospatial, sensor, agronomic, and supply chain data sources (integration middleware)
More About Agstack
Agstack operates as a project within the Linux Foundation ecosystem, focused on open-source building blocks for digital agriculture. Its scope covers data models, reference architectures, software components, and interoperability standards that support applications used by growers, agronomists, ag retailers, food companies, NGOs, and public-sector institutions. Instead of operating as a commercial Software-as-a-Service (SaaS) provider, Agstack provides upstream community assets that enterprises and solution vendors can adopt, extend, or embed into their own agritech platforms.
The project concentrates on common horizontal capabilities that recur across agricultural technology solutions, such as geospatial data integration, sensor and Internet of Things (IoT) data handling (data platforms), and standardized representations of fields, crops, inputs, and practices (data management). By defining shared schemas, vocabularies, and APIs, Agstack seeks to lower integration effort between heterogeneous data sources, including farm management systems, remote sensing providers, equipment telematics, and supply chain traceability systems. These technical building blocks can be used as reference implementations or incorporated directly into production platforms by enterprises or system integrators.
Architecturally, Agstack emphasizes modular, composable components aligned with common cloud-native patterns. Solutions typically use containerized services, microservices, and RESTful or event-driven APIs (cloud services) that can deploy to Kubernetes-based environments or public cloud infrastructure. The project also references and reuses existing open standards and technologies where applicable, such as geospatial standards from Open Geospatial Consortium (OGC) for mapping and spatial analysis, common open data licenses, and established open-source databases and processing frameworks. This orientation enables enterprise architects to align Agstack assets with existing DevOps, Continuous Integration and Continuous Deployment (CI/CD), and data engineering toolchains.
From an enterprise usage standpoint, Agstackās artifacts can serve as a foundation for building agronomic decision-support tools, sustainability reporting pipelines, supply chain provenance solutions, and national or regional agricultural data platforms. Public agencies and NGOs can use the reference models and open components to implement interoperable registries or advisory systems without creating proprietary lock-in. Commercial agritech vendors can adopt Agstack-defined interfaces and data models to improve interoperability with partners and customers, while still differentiating at the application and analytics layers.
In a directory or marketplace taxonomy, Agstack aligns with categories such as agricultural data platforms (data management), geospatial and sensor data integration (integration middleware), open-source frameworks for digital agriculture (cloud services), and sector-specific data standards for food and agriculture. Its focus on open governance, shared schemas, and reusable components positions the project as a technical collaboration layer that enterprises can incorporate when designing scalable, interoperable digital agriculture architectures.